/**
** This class represents chess logic, utilised in the ChessSim program.
**/
/**
** @author Ben Goldsworthy (rumperuu) <me+chesssim@bengoldsworthy.net>
** @version 0.90
**/
public class ChessLogic {
// rumperuu <3 C-style pre-processor macros
private final int DEFAULT = 0, PIECESELECTED = 1;
// stores the current state of the game
private int currentState;
/**
** Constructor function.
**/
public ChessLogic() {
currentState = DEFAULT;
}
/**
** Determines if a given rank is the top or bottom two.
** @param y the rank number
** @return a boolean value
**/
public boolean startingRow(int y) {
return (((y <= 1) || (y >= 6)) ? true : false);
}
/**
** Determines if a given rank is either team's back rank. Currently
** used to populate pieces, but could also be called to deal with pawn
** promotion if I ever got around to adding that.
** @param y the rank number
** @return a boolean value
**/
public boolean backRank(int y) {
return (((y == 0) || (y == 7)) ? true: false);
}
/**
** Gets the current state of this chess game.
** @return the state of this chess game
*/
public int getState() {
return currentState;
}
/**
** Sets the state of this chess game.
** @param state the state of this chess game
*/
public void setState(int state) {
currentState = state;
}
}
